In Australia, a full time Animal Control Officer generally earns $1,518 per week ($78,520 annual salary) before tax. This is a median figure for full-time employees and should be considered a guide only. As you gain more experience you can expect a potentially higher salary than people who are new to the industry.

There are currently 16,500 animal attendants in Australia and many of them are employed as Animal Control Officers. This number is expected to increase over the next five years. Animal Control Officers can be found in all areas of Australia.

Source: The Labour Market Information Portal – 2019 Occupation Projections

A Certificate III in Animal Studies is a good option if you’re considering becoming an Animal Control Officer. This course usually takes six months and covers everything you need to know about the care, capture, handling and transportation of animals.

If you're looking to become an Animal Control Officer in Sydney, there are several comprehensive training options available to help you kickstart your career in this vital field. With a total of five Animal Control Officer courses in Sydney, learners can choose from both beginner and advanced options tailored to meet various experience levels. Popular beginner courses include the Certificate III in Urban Pest Management CPP30119 and the Certificate III in Animal Care Services ACM30122, both designed for those with no prior experience or qualifications.

For those seeking to advance their skills, the Animal Control Officer courses in Sydney include esteemed options such as the Certificate IV in Animal Regulation and Management ACM40122 and the Certificate IV in Urban Pest Management CPP41619. These advanced courses are suitable for learners with prior experience, enabling them to deepen their understanding of animal welfare regulations and management practices vital in urban settings like Sydney.

In addition to becoming an Animal Control Officer, graduates may also consider roles such as an Animal Shelter Attendant, Animal Shelter Manager, or an Animal Management Officer. Each of these roles plays an essential part in protecting animal welfare and ensuring community safety throughout Sydney.

Moreover, if you're passionate about wildlife, you might find positions as a Wildlife Management Officer or an Wildlife Officer appealing, as these roles involve managing and preserving the diverse ecosystems in and around Sydney. Additionally, consider the role of an Animal Welfare Officer, where you can advocate for the rights and wellbeing of animals.
